Re: Managing keywords to filter tickets to the queue

Post by yuri0001 »

Hi!
Depending on how customers create the tickets, there two or more ways: PostMaster filters for e-mail tickets & GenericAgent for tickets from customer web-interface. More ACL feature. :) See manual
